Asbestos-Related Illnesses

A variety of asbestos-related illnesses can be triggered because of exposure to the toxic mineral. The most severe condition is mesothelioma. Mesothelioma is the cause of death of many people. Other asbestos-related diseases include lung cancer and asbestosis. Pleural plaques and pleural effusion are also asbestos-related.

Mesothelioma, a rare, but fatal disease is caused by asbestos fibers that collect in the lungs. They then cause irritation to the linings of the ribcage (the pleura), chest cavity and abdominal cavity. The inhalation of these small fibers can cause scarring to the lungs called asbestosis, and, sometimes, the development of thickened patches on the pleura, known as pleural plaques or the more widespread fibrosis of the pleura, referred to as diffused pleural fibrisis. Pleural plaques and diffused fibrisis reduce lung capacity as determined by breathing tests. They can also cause breathing problems and pain, though they do not lead to cancer or mesothelioma.

The symptoms of asbestos-related diseases typically are not evident until years after exposure. This is because it can take between 20 to 50 years for inhalation of asbestos-containing fibers to damage the lungs. Many states have established special asbestos courts, where claims can be filed more efficiently. In addition judges have developed special procedures for evaluating and resolving asbestos cases.

New York, a state which has its own asbestos law court (known as NYCAL), is one of them. As asbestos victims continue to seek compensation from solvent asbestos defendants that have been bankrupt the number of cases that have come through this special court has steadily increased. To ensure that the justice system does not get overloaded the New York Supreme Court has created an additional judicial panel that will supervise NYCAL.

A panel of six Supreme Court Judges will review each case to determine if it should be accepted or rejected. Judges will also consider the merits of every claim to determine how much money each plaintiff should receive.
